Distance in mm or inches between centers of adjacent joint members. Other
dimensions are proportional to the pitch. Also known as pitch.
partition
The diameter of the pitch circle that passes through the centers of the link pins
as the chain is wrapped on the sprocket.
pitch diameter
A roller chain is made up of two kinds of links: roller links and pin links alternately
and evenly spaced throughout the length of the chain.
roller chain
A toothed wheel that transfers the power from the chain to the shaft or the
other way round.
sprocket
